There’s currently 45 ships visiting Aberdeen during this year’s Tall Ships Races from 19-22 July! ⚓️⛵️ These magnificent vessels, divided into four classes, range from large sailing ships to smaller single-masted boats. Some of the great ships you’ll see this summer include: 🔹Corsaro II – A stunning yacht used for sail training third-year students of the Italian Naval Academy. 🔹Dars Szczecina – Owned by the City of Szczecin in Poland, this ship has been a regular participant in the Tall Ships Races since 1976 and is typically by manned by students from the city. 🔹Rona II (pictured) – Built in 1991, Rona II is renowned as one of the hardest-working and most resilient Oyster yachts in the world.
